What Are Sliding Windows? Sliding windows, as the name suggests, are windows that open horizontally by sliding along a track. Normally constructed with 2 or more sashes, among which might be fixed while the others move, sliding windows produce a large expanse of glass, enabling unobstructed views and natural light. These windows can be made from numerous materials, including wood, vinyl, fiberglass, and aluminum, each offering unique qualities and benefits.
Secret Features of Sliding Windows Sliding windows included a series of features that add to their appeal among house owners and home builders:
Energy Efficiency: Modern sliding windows frequently integrate energy-efficient glazing choices that help lessen heat transfer, helping in temperature level policy within the home.
Space-Saving Design: Unlike traditional windows that swing open, sliding windows do not need additional area, making them perfect for tight areas where swinging doors would be not practical.
Ease of Use: Most sliding windows are easy to run, typically requiring only a mild push to open and close.
Aesthetic Appeal: With their expansive glass surface areas, sliding windows create an open, airy feel and can enhance the visual appeal of both interiors and exteriors.
Variety of Styles: Sliding windows can be found in various designs, sizes, and colors, making them adaptable to different architectural styles.
Advantages of Sliding Windows The advantages related to sliding windows make them an appealing choice for both new constructions and renovations. Below are some essential benefits:
1. Natural Ventilation Airflow: Sliding windows can assist in reliable air flow, allowing house owners to manage ventilation throughout their home. Cross-Ventilation: When installed in pairs, sliding windows can encourage cross-ventilation, therefore improving indoor air quality. 2. Enhanced Views Unblocked Sightlines: The horizontal design of sliding windows reduces frame blockages, providing stunning, breathtaking views of the outdoors. Increased Light: The big glass surface area optimizes daylight, which can reduce dependence on synthetic lighting. 3. Energy Savings Insulating Properties: Properly set up sliding windows with double or triple glazing can considerably minimize cooling and heating costs. UV Protection: Many sliding windows included built-in UV filters that safeguard indoor furnishings from fading. 4. Low Maintenance Toughness: Sliding windows made from materials like vinyl or fiberglass require very little maintenance and can endure severe climate condition. Easy Cleaning: The design of sliding windows permits simple access to both sides of the glass, simplifying the cleansing procedure.
